PiggyBack Pack
Description
Small but packed with modularity, the 10L (600 cu. in.) PiggyBack Pack is designed to attach to our chest rig-kit bag Shoulder Harness or independently to the Small Pack Straps while capable of carrying 3L (100 oz.) water bladders up to 16" tall and 10" wide, comms equipment, or other gear. It lays nearly flat at only 4" deep but has just enough room for a bladder and other items.
It integrates perfectly with our chest rig-kit bag shoulder harness so it can be worn as a complete one-piece rig. Our Small Pack Straps also connect to the PiggyBack to be used as a standalone EDC pack. There are included 1" webbing straps to connect to the chest rig-kit bag harness and extension straps to be used as small shoulder straps.
The pack can also be used as a beavertail/piggyback on our Minuteman Packs or other compatible rucksacks by connecting it to the compression straps, as well as top and bottom connection points. Drop your larger ruck at base camp and detach the PiggyBack to use for a day hike.
There is a front zippered admin pocket that runs the full length of the bag with laser-cut PALS/MOLLE for attaching additional gear. Lashing loops all over the pack make it extremely versatile for running shock/bungee cord and attaching the PiggyBack to larger packs or plate carriers. Our larger packs all have removable compression straps that seamlessly integrate directly with the PiggyBack.
The internal divider contains a removable 1/4" stiff foam panel for structure and extra comfort. The bag is designed so that hydration tubes come out of either side of the zipper, meaning you can route it left, right, or even center top. There are dual zipper sliders to hold tubes in place whichever direction you choose to route them.
